public class LiteralType extends ExpressionType implements Visitable
Java class for LiteralType complex type.
The following schema fragment specifies the expected content contained within this class.
<complexType name="LiteralType"> <complexContent> <extension base="{http://www.opengis.net/ogc}ExpressionType"> <sequence> <any minOccurs="0"/> </sequence> </extension> </complexContent> </complexType>

public List<Serializable> getContent()
This accessor method returns a reference to the live list,
not a snapshot. Therefore any modification you make to the
returned list will be present inside the JAXB object.
This is why there is not a set
method for the content property.
For example, to add a new item, do as follows:
getContent().add(newItem);
Objects of the following type(s) are allowed in the list
Object
String
